Sadly, Gray Stone Day is still looking for their first win of the season after 11 matches. They fell just short of the Forest Hills Yellow Jackets by a score of 8-7 on Wednesday. One positive for Gray Stone Day, at least, is that this was the most points they've scored all season.
Gray Stone Day saw six different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Cliffton Hatley, who scored a run and stole a base while going 4-for-4.
Gray Stone Day's loss dropped their record down to 0-11. As for Forest Hills, their win ended a three-game drought at home and bumped them up to 2-9.
Gray Stone Day will head out on the road to face off against North Stanly at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. North Stanly is coming into the matchup with nine straight victories at home, so Gray Stone Day will have to stop a squad with plenty of momentum. Forest Hills will take on Central Academy at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
